Plato Gold Corp. (CVE:PGC – Get Free Report)’s share price was down 14.3% on Monday . The company traded as low as C$0.03 and last traded at C$0.03. Approximately 89,630 shares changed hands during mid-day trading, an increase of 51% from the average daily volume of 59,396 shares. The stock had previously closed at C$0.04.
Plato Gold Stock Performance
The company has a quick ratio of 0.21, a current ratio of 0.03 and a debt-to-equity ratio of -498.16. The company has a market capitalization of C$6.92 million, a P/E ratio of -3.00 and a beta of -0.58. The firm’s 50-day moving average price is C$0.03 and its 200 day moving average price is C$0.03.
Plato Gold Company Profile
Plato Gold Corp., an exploration company, engages in the exploration and development of gold and rare mineral properties in Canada. The company is based in Toronto, Canada.
